
In October, Anastasia Reshetova and Timati should become parents. For Nastya, this is the first child, so special attention from the press and fans is riveted to the girl. To exclude the spread of gossip, Anastasia published a post on Instagram, in which she promised to answer subscribers' questions. Here's what the girl said about her pregnancy and the upcoming birth.
About the condition during pregnancy
One of the subscribers asked what was the most pleasant thing during pregnancy. To which Nastya briefly replied: the realization that your bloodline lives inside you. A little earlier, the girl devoted a separate post to this topic, in which she said that for all 9 months there were moments when it was very difficult in terms of well-being: “I shouted with fervor“Well, I'd rather give birth!”. But in fact, I perfectly understand that it is better to enjoy every minute while one more heart beats in you. It's a really magical time. And then another story will begin, no less magical, but different."
About recovery from pregnancy
Many fans are interested in the topic of Nastya's recovery after pregnancy, so the most frequent questions are: "Are there stretch marks" and "How will you deal with them?" The girl honestly told that she had stretch marks on her stomach, and they are very noticeable: “Although I used special oils twice every day. This is genetics, and here it is hardly possible to avoid them, but if you start to eliminate them in time, then everything will be ok. " Anastasia promised fans a detailed history of getting rid of stretch marks and even a photo: “As I start the process of dealing with them, I will definitely share with you. I will also show a photo of stretch marks. Of the procedures, I think it will be plasma and resurfacing."
Earlier, Nastya said that during pregnancy she gained 13 kg.
About gender and name of the child
Nastya answered honestly that she would not tell the child's gender and name, and this is a well-grounded decision: “Parents often hide this information before giving birth, and some even after”.
About Timur's presence at childbirth
The couple is planning a partner birth. When asked about Timur's presence at childbirth, Nastya confidently answered: “Of course! This sacrament is a process that a couple must live together."
Children will give birth in Russia. “Another option was not even considered,” said Nastya.
